Comics is a form of medium that combines the elements of words and cartoon pictures. It is easy to read and it can easily send a message in a single strip, double strip or multiple strip. Comics is a medium to spark reading among young people.

While this used to be a medium in print, it has also evolved along the way, just like any media as technology progressed.

There are several online applications that can generate comics. There are also mobile tools to create comics or cartoon characters. I have seen four or five and I found BITSTRIPS and StripGenerator can comfortably handle creation of strips, selection of characters and plotting of the script or conversations.

Comics can be a creative tool for teachers to ask students compose their thoughts in short, concise set of words.

As to StripGenerator, I recommend it for English Teachers to use. It is an effective way of creating memory recall of class rules, studying techniques or even reinforcing positive values and good behavior.
